This gold HooXi sticker commemorates the Budapest 2025 CS2 Major Championship. It can be applied to any weapon and scraped multiple times to achieve a worn look, signed by professional player Rasmus Nielsen from Astralis.
The Sticker | HooXi (Gold) | Budapest 2025 made its debut in CS2 just two weeks ago, on November 12th, 2025, as part of the Budapest 2025 Challengers Autograph Capsule. This item was launched alongside the "Budapest 2025 Stickers" update, adding a touch of luxury and exclusivity to the game's collection.
The Sticker | HooXi (Gold) | Budapest 2025 is acquired by opening a Budapest 2025 Challengers Autograph Capsule. This item is not included in any collections within the game.
